About this item

Product Details

The Zwilling 1103318 Staub® Cocotte is a cast iron Dutch oven designed for commercial kitchen environments requiring durable, high-performance cookware. With a 7-quart capacity and measuring 15.7" x 12.9" x 6.8" overall, this oval-shaped enameled cast iron vessel offers optimal heat retention and distribution. Its graphite grey finish complements professional kitchen aesthetics, while its dishwasher-safe and oven-safe-to-572°F features ensure versatile operation across multiple heat sources, including induction. Engineered for steady and consistent cooking, this Staub® cocotte supports foodservice applications such as braising, roasting, and slow cooking at scale, making it suitable for institutional kitchens and mid-volume food preparation settings.

What is a commercial cast iron Dutch oven?

A commercial cast iron Dutch oven is a high-capacity, durable cookware designed for consistent use in professional foodservice settings. The Zwilling 1103318 Staub® Cocotte facilitates slow braising, roasting, and stewing with its heat-retentive cast iron body and an enameled surface that simplifies cleaning. Installed in mid-volume kitchens or institutional environments, it supports culinary processes requiring even heat distribution and tough construction, making it suitable for prolonged cooking cycles. Its 7-quart capacity, paired with oven safe to 572°F, makes it well-suited for restaurant or catering operations that produce large quantities of prepared dishes efficiently.
